01/20/2020 (US) • 1h 10m
Overview
After Paul Hanson agrees to a last minute business meeting on Christmas Eave, He finds himself constantly overcoming repeated obstacles while trying to make it home in time for the big Christmas Extravaganza.
© All Rights Reserved 2025